"Albana, I have 0900 for you", Belind Këlliçi: Shocking statement, Balla has suffered at his expense

Belind Këlliçi, a member of parliament for the Democratic Party, invited to the "Off the Record" studio by Andrea Danglli, on A2CNN, commented on Taulant Balla's statements in Parliament this afternoon.
"We have seen shocking images and shocking statements from Parliament a few minutes ago, where the highest leader of the Socialist Party in the Assembly of the Republic of Albania, Taulant Balla, has insulted like never before, it is an unprecedented case, a woman, a lady deputy of the Democratic Party, the president of the Women's League, has insulted the deputy president of the Women's Organization of the European People's Party, with the most banal and severe vocabulary that he himself has complained about for years, for two decades, that he has suffered at his expense. And this climate has certainly been brought about by an individual and a government, a decision-making that emanates from the leader, it emanates from Edi Rama", said Këlliçi.
"Today you have a discussion in parliament where not only what was said at the beginning, the prime minister was not present when half of his cabinet was being reformed and I am reforming it, his right-hand man number two in the government was also being replaced. But you don't even have the ministers present. Every time we have a debate, we ask for a motion with debate, we ask to make a reply, we ask to ask questions to the government cabinet, not only is the prime minister not present, but the ministers are no longer present either. And in this way, the Parliament itself has completely lost its function, its mission. There is no accountability there," Këlliçi added.
